LONDON - Jehova's Witnesses said yesterday they were concerned for the family of a young mother who died after giving birth to twins because her faith prevented her from accepting a blood transfusion.

Emma Gough, 22, of Telford, Shropshire, in England, gave birth to a baby boy and girl at Royal Shrewsbury Hospital last Thursday. But complications set in after she suffered severe blood loss. Witnesses believe the Bible prohibits the accepting of blood. - Reuters
